    fuel problem

    Hi I have a 2001 max II with a 16 hp briggs and it fills the crank case up with fuel so I bought a brand new carb for it bk a mechanic said that the needle seat was bad. Well it is still filling up with fuel. What can be causing this?

    Usually a ruptured diaphragm in the fuel pump drawing fuel into tube in valvecover. Test by applying vacuum to the pulse line ( from valvecover). It should hold vacuum. They usually leak gas out the vent holes on top or bottom but not always a very plugged air filter will cause the engine to run rich and dilute the oil with fuel.
